On Monday the Podcast had the chance to sit down with the New Chairman of Wigan, Professor Chris Brookes
https://open.spotify.com/episode/6B3Vou ... 3Jku_fyohg Over nearly 2hrs we gained a fascinating insight into the life and background of Chris Brookes, getting the chance to hear about his journey both within the game and his personal and professional career in medicine.
